Ticket: Reminder job skipped evening batch — needs sign-off

The Caretide clinic reminder job skipped its 18:00 batch after a timezone table update; patients in the affected window received no messages. A replay script has been prepared and dry-run verified against staging — it sends only to appointments still more than 12 hours out, so no duplicates or late-night sends. Before the on-call engineer executes the replay in production, we need written sign-off from the service owner named below.

approver of faduf-bagug = Framir Sorwyn

As a contractor, you normally interact with Proselint-D through the standard CI pipeline, which requires no credentials. Break-glass access exists solely for cases where the linter's rule registry becomes corrupted and blocks all documentation merges across teams. Before invoking it, confirm with the platform channel that no maintainer is available, and file an incident record first. Access is audited and expires after one hour. To open the emergency console, enter the recovery passphrase shown immediately below.

strongbox words: norwyn-wenael-aldvan-aldiel-wendor-holael

Subject: DR drill results — Renderbarn transcoding farm

Team,

Thursday's disaster-recovery drill for the Renderbarn transcoding farm completed in 42 minutes, within target. We failed over all worker pools to the Eastvale site, replayed the job queue, and verified output checksums on sample renders. One gap: the standby coordinator node required manual unsealing of its credentials store, which cost us eight minutes. For future drills (and real incidents), unseal the standby coordinator with the recovery passphrase given below.

strongbox words: prawyn-fenmir

**Handover: flaky DNS on quillhost resolvers**

Status for Bren. Intermittent NXDOMAIN on internal lookups from the fennel-api pods, roughly 1 in 400 queries. Only hits the Varnmoor cluster. Suspect stale negative caching in the sidecar resolver; TTL overrides look wrong. Packet captures are in the shared drive under handover-dns. Tried bumping retries — masks it, doesn't fix it. Next step: compare resolver settings against the Dellwick cluster, which is clean. Current resolver config on Varnmoor follows.

deployment values, fajog-fajog:
zorael:
  log_level: info
  metrics_host: metrics.zorael.lumicsys.internal
  pool_size: 16